Natural Hint Of The Day: Mice, Ants, and Cockroaches Be Gone!

As winter descends we may find our homes invaded by uninvited guests.  Peppermint essential oil is a powerful and safe ally in preventing or interrupting the onslaught.  The scent that is so delicious to us sends them running for the hills!  Simply soak (approximately 5 drops) a cotton ball with high quality peppermint oil (quality counts) and place in the right spot.  What is the right spot?  If your problem is mice it is best to act preventatively.  The cotton balls are most effective when placed at possible points of entry or protectively around items you don’t want them getting into.  As a preventative measure they significantly reduce chances of an infestation even starting.  No stress, no poisons, no moments of “ick factor.”  After the rascals are in your home its a bit more challenging.  The peppermint soaked cotton balls are still powerful but they won’t make the mice leave the home.  There are still many “non peppermint” places to hide.  They can be used as a protective hedge around whatever you don’t want them accessing.  Encroachment stopped!  As for ants and cockroaches simply place the balls in any paths or where activity is noted and voila!  They will retreat to sweeter smelling adventures.  Here’s to safe and effective natural remedies!

Easy Indoor Composting–Black Gold With No Mess, No Hassle, And No Smell

IMG_3954

Compost is a gardeners’ dream.  Black and loamy it sifts gently and easily through the fingers yet with enough time–can turn even the most unworkable soil into perfection.  Watching the rock hard clay of Northern Virginia turn into workable soil that breaks apart and allows water to drain makes me break into my “happy dance.”  In addition, good compost provides almost every conceivable nutrient/mineral that plants need to thrive; and, that will eventually be transferred to us when they grace our plates.  Chemical/artificial fertilizers are often devoid of the trace minerals plants need and do nothing to improve the soil.  They are also are derived primarily from nonrenewable sources including fossil fuels which are bad for the planet.  This is compounded by the fact that chemical fertilizers tend to “run off” quickly and easily which necessitates multiple applications.  Finally, over time these repeat applications can create a buildup of toxic substances in the soil such as arsenic, cadmium, and uranium that get taken into the plants/fruits/vegetables we are growing. I am not a fan of ingesting these substances.  Yuck!  Especially when there is a natural alternative that strengthens the soil, our plants, and our bodies without poisoning the planet or our health.
